Les pragmatic slots sont essentiels dans la monétisation des applications mobiles et sites web interactifs, notamment dans le cadre de campagnes publicitaires ou de recommandations dynamiques. Toutefois, leur performance peut fortement impacter l’expérience utilisateur, surtout sur des dispositifs mobiles où les ressources sont limitées. Dans cet article, nous explorerons des stratégies concrètes pour optimiser la rapidité d’exécution de ces éléments, en permettant une meilleure réactivité, une réduction des temps de chargement et une expérience fluide. Après une introduction générale, voici un aperçu des sections abordées :
Adapter l’interface utilisateur pour une performance optimale
Mettre en œuvre des stratégies de caching avancées
Utiliser des outils pour analyser et améliorer la performance en temps réel
Optimiser la configuration technique pour un chargement plus rapide
Choisir des scripts légers et adaptés aux mobiles
Le premier pas vers une meilleure performance consiste à réduire la poids des scripts utilisés pour le déploiement des pragmatic slots. Des études indiquent que la taille d’un script peut influencer directement le temps de chargement, notamment sur des connexions mobiles souvent moins rapides. Privilégier des scripts minifiés, modulaires et compatibles avec la dernière norme ECMAScript permet d’obtenir des chargements plus rapides.
Par exemple, en optant pour des versions construites avec des outils comme Webpack ou Rollup, il est possible de tree-shaker et éliminer le code inutile, évitant ainsi de charger des fonctionnalités non utilisées. Utiliser des scripts asynchrones ou différés (async ou defer) réduit également le blocage du rendu initial, accélérant la disponibilité des pragmatic slots aux utilisateurs.
Utiliser des réseaux de distribution de contenu (CDN) pour accélérer la livraison des ressources
Les CDN sont des réseaux géographiquement distribués qui stockent en cache les ressources statiques telles que scripts, images et styles CSS. Leur utilisation garantit que les utilisateurs accèdent aux contenus depuis le serveur le plus proche, diminuant ainsi la latence. Des études montrent que le recours à un CDN peut réduire le temps de chargement jusqu’à 50%.
Par exemple, en intégrant un CDN comme Cloudflare ou Akamai, la distribution des scripts et ressources nécessaires pour appuyer les slots pragmatiques devient plus rapide, notamment pour une audience mondiale. Cette accélération est cruciale pour garantir que les pragmatic slots s’exécutent sans délai perceptible, même sur des réseaux instables ou lents.
Mettre en place le lazy loading pour les éléments non essentiels
Le lazy loading, ou chargement différé, consiste à charger les éléments non visibles initialement seulement lorsqu’ils deviennent nécessaires. Sur une page contenant plusieurs slots pragmatiques, cette technique évite de charger tous les éléments en début de chargement, ce qui accélère la mise en ligne de la page et la disponibilité des slots visibles.
Par exemple, en appliquant le lazy loading sur les images ou scripts non critiques, on diminue la consommation de ressources initiales. Selon des études, cela peut réduire le temps de chargement perçu par l’utilisateur de 30 à 40%, tout en maintenant une expérience fluide lors du défilement ou de l’interaction.
Adapter l’interface utilisateur pour une performance optimale
Réduire la taille des éléments graphiques et privilégier le format SVG
Les éléments graphiques volumineux ralentissent le chargement des pages sur mobiles, notamment si leur format est non optimisé. Privilégier le format SVG pour les pictogrammes et logos permet non seulement de réduire la taille, mais aussi d’assurer une netteté optimale sur tous les écrans.
Une étude de l’organisme Google Chrome indique que l’utilisation du SVG peut réduire la taille des images jusqu’à 70% par rapport aux formats tels que PNG ou JPEG, tout en améliorant la réactivité lors de l’affichage de pragmatic slots. La simplicité et la scalabilité du SVG en font une solution idéale pour optimiser la vitesse d’affichage.
Optimiser la gestion des animations pour limiter leur impact sur la vitesse
Les animations, lorsqu’elles sont mal gérées, peuvent considérablement ralentir la performance. Sur mobile, il est conseillé d’utiliser des animations CSS plutôt que Javascript car elles sont généralement plus légères et sont exécutées par le GPU, ce qui libère le CPU pour d’autres tâches.
Il est également important de limiter la quantité et la complexité des animations, en évitant par exemple des animations continues ou des effets impactant le rendu lors de l’interaction avec les slots pragmatiques. La simplification de l’animation contribue à conserver une vitesse d’exécution optimale.
Simplifier la navigation pour diminuer le temps de chargement des pages
Une navigation complexe ou trop d’interactions peuvent prolonger le chargement global, notamment si des ressources sont chargées à chaque étape. Il faut privilégier une structure simple, avec un nombre limité de transitions et de requêtes serveur par page.
Une navigation simplifiée, avec un chargement initial optimisé, permet aux pragmatic slots d’être rapidement visibles et interactifs, réduisant considérablement le taux d’abandon et améliorant l’expérience utilisateur.
Mettre en œuvre des stratégies de caching avancées
Configurer le cache pour stocker localement les données des slots pragmatiques
La mise en cache locale des données permet de réduire drastiquement le nombre de requêtes serveur nécessaires pour récupérer les slots pragmatiques. En utilisant des techniques telles que le localStorage ou IndexedDB, il est possible de stocker les configurations, statistiques ou autres données dynamiques, ce qui peut également contribuer à optimiser votre expérience de jeu, notamment en découvrant des offres comme spinsahara bonus sans dépôt.
Par exemple, un cache bien configuré peut contenir à l’avance les recommandations ou les annonces, ce qui élimine la latence liée à leur chargement lors de chaque interaction utilisateur. Selon une étude de Google, cette approche peut améliorer la vitesse perçue par l’utilisateur de 25%.
Utiliser des techniques de cache côté client pour réduire les requêtes serveur
Les stratégies de cache côté client, telles que les en-têtes HTTP Cache-Control ou ETag, permettent aux navigateurs ou applications mobiles de vérifier si une ressource a été modifiée avant de la recharger. Cela évite de recharger inutilement des scripts ou données qui n’ont pas changé.
Par exemple, en configurant un temps d’expiration adapté, on garantit que les pragmatic slots restent à jour tout en conservant une rapidité d’exécution. Cette gestion fine du cache contribue à une expérience fluide et sans délais inutiles.
Mettre à jour régulièrement le cache pour garantir la fraîcheur des données
Une problématique centrale est la synchronisation entre performance et actualité. Il est important d’établir une politique de mise à jour du cache pour s’assurer que, même si la vitesse est optimisée, les données restent pertinentes.
Des mécanismes automatiques, comme le rafraîchissement périodique ou la validation via ETag, offrent un équilibre entre rapidité et fraîcheur, évitant aux utilisateurs de recevoir des recommandations obsolètes ou incorrectes.
Utiliser des outils pour analyser et améliorer la performance en temps réel
Intégrer des solutions de monitoring pour détecter les ralentissements
Pour assurer une optimisation continue, il est indispensable d’employer des outils de monitoring comme Google Lighthouse, New Relic Mobile ou DataDog. Ces solutions permettent de suivre en temps réel la performance des pragmatic slots, d’identifier des ralentissements ou des erreurs de chargement.
Par exemple, un tableau de bord peut mettre en évidence des délais dans l’exécution ou le chargement de certains scripts, permettant d’intervenir rapidement pour corriger ou ajuster les configurations.
Exploiter les rapports d’analyse pour cibler les éléments à optimiser
Les rapports analytiques, issus d’outils ou de tests utilisateurs, révèlent quels éléments impactent le plus la vitesse ou la réactivité. En se concentrant sur ces zones, il est possible d’allouer efficacement les ressources pour des optimisations ciblées.
Une approche analytique favorise donc une amélioration continue, basée sur des données concrètes. Par exemple, en identifiant une animation spécifique qui ralentit l’interaction, on peut la simplifier ou la désactiver.
Tester régulièrement la vitesse d’exécution sur différents appareils mobiles
Les performances varient selon les modèles et versions d’OS. Il est crucial de réaliser des tests périodiques pour garantir une performance homogène. Des outils comme BrowserStack ou Sauce Labs permettent d’effectuer des benchmarks sur un large éventail d’appareils.
Ces tests garantissent que les pragmatic slots restent performants même sur les appareils les plus limités, et que l’expérience utilisateur ne se dégrade pas avec le temps ou les mises à jour technologiques.
Conclusion
« La clé pour des pragmatic slots rapides et efficaces sur mobile est une approche globale : optimiser la technique, l’interface, le cache et l’analyse en continu. »
En appliquant ces stratégies concrètes et en s’appuyant sur une analyse régulière, il est possible d’assurer que les pragmatic slots s’exécutent avec une rapidité optimale, offrant ainsi une expérience utilisateur de qualité tout en maximisant la performance et le retour sur investissement.
Deixe um comentário